Consumers, House panel demand return of pipelines

Consumer advocacy groups and a House committee yesterday petitioned the Supreme Administrative Court to demand that PTT Plc return all gas pipelines to the state.

Consumer activists led by Bangkok senator Rosana Tositrakul, centre, show up in force at the Administrative Court to lodge a petition demanding PTT return all gas pipelines. TAWATCHAI KEMGUMNERD

The Foundation for Consumers and its partners along with the House committee on education, corruption investigation and good governance asked the court in a petition to instruct PTT to fully comply with its earlier ruling for the firm to return to the state all assets acquired when the firm was still a state enterprise.
